11 | help |
12 | The "Serial Peripheral Interface" is a low level synchronous | |
13 | protocol. Chips that support SPI can have data transfer rates | |
14 | up to several tens of Mbit/sec. Chips are addressed with a | |
15 | controller and a chipselect. Most SPI slaves don't support | |
16 | dynamic device discovery; some are even write-only or read-only. | |
17 | ||
3cb2fccc | 18 | SPI is widely used by microcontrollers to talk with sensors, |
8ae12a0d DB |
19 | eeprom and flash memory, codecs and various other controller |
20 | chips, analog to digital (and d-to-a) converters, and more. | |
21 | MMC and SD cards can be accessed using SPI protocol; and for | |
22 | DataFlash cards used in MMC sockets, SPI must always be used. | |
23 | ||
24 | SPI is one of a family of similar protocols using a four wire | |
25 | interface (select, clock, data in, data out) including Microwire | |
26 | (half duplex), SSP, SSI, and PSP. This driver framework should | |
27 | work with most such devices and controllers. | |

9904f22a | 173 | config SPI_BITBANG |
d29389de | 174 | tristate "Utilities for Bitbanging SPI masters" |
9904f22a DB |
175 | help |
176 | With a few GPIO pins, your system can bitbang the SPI protocol. | |
177 | Select this to get SPI support through I/O pins (GPIO, parallel | |
178 | port, etc). Or, some systems' SPI master controller drivers use | |
179 | this code to manage the per-word or per-transfer accesses to the | |
180 | hardware shift registers. | |
181 | ||
182 | This is library code, and is automatically selected by drivers that | |
183 | need it. You only need to select this explicitly to support driver | |
184 | modules that aren't part of this kernel tree. | |

280 | config SPI_GPIO |
281 | tristate "GPIO-based bitbanging SPI Master" | |
5c2301a9 | 282 | depends on GPIOLIB || COMPILE_TEST |
d29389de DB |
283 | select SPI_BITBANG |
284 | help | |
285 | This simple GPIO bitbanging SPI master uses the arch-neutral GPIO | |
286 | interface to manage MOSI, MISO, SCK, and chipselect signals. SPI | |
287 | slaves connected to a bus using this driver are configured as usual, | |
288 | except that the spi_board_info.controller_data holds the GPIO number | |
289 | for the chipselect used by this controller driver. | |
290 | ||
291 | Note that this driver often won't achieve even 1 Mbit/sec speeds, | |
292 | making it unusually slow for SPI. If your platform can inline | |
293 | GPIO operations, you should be able to leverage that for better | |
294 | speed with a custom version of this driver; see the source code. | |
